Fifth annual Safford High School Art Show coming in May

Safford High School Art instructor Aubrey Zaugg, center, talks about the art pieces submitted by her students with judges Royce Hunt-Bell and Holt Brasher, in advance of Safford High School's fifth annual Student Art Show May 5-7. - David Bell Photo/Gila Valley Central

SAFFORD — The future of art will be on exhibit in two weeks.

Upward of 150 students are participating in the fifth annual Safford High School Student Art Show, May 5-7, from 6-7:30 p.m. each night, in the small gymnasium.

Art 1 students selected two pieces they created during the year for judging, while upper level students submitted three pieces for judging in any category.

“And then my seniors get a Senior Show. They get an entire spread, whatever they want to put in,” said Art instructor and show organizer Aubrey Zaugg. “They still get the same three — they pick three of their favorites to be judged — and the rest they just get to put up.”

Admission to the show is free and the public is invited to view the students’ work.
